Definition
A sports team that plays a ball game.
neutralsports
How it's used
Refers specifically to organized groups competing in ball games, distinguishing it from general groups or organizations. It is almost exclusively used for sports teams where players work together under a common banner. When discussing the collective effort of the members, speakers often focus on the team's performance or its need for new talent.

Common mistake
Do not use this to refer to a group of people in a general sense, such as a work team or a project group, as those are better described as 組 or 團隊. Using it for non-sports contexts sounds unnatural and confusing to native speakers.
